function [out] = p4(x)
L = 600;
E = 50000;
I = 30000;
w0 = 2.5;
out = (w0/120*E*I*L) * (-5*x^4 + 6*L^2*x^2 - L^4); % derivative of y(x)
end % I am getting x = 268.3282
Above is a function p4 I made. I am trying to solve for where p4 = 0, or the slope of y(x) = 0. I have plugged in the equation into symbolab.com and solved for x and it confirmed my result, x = 268.3282, however when I plug that value into p4, it does not equal 0, this is the value I recieve: p4(x) = 858306.884766. I do not understand, could someone please explain.

out = w0/(120*E*I*L) * (-5*x^4 + 6*L^2*x^2 - L^4); % derivative of y(x)
I figured it out, it was a perthesis error. I had it as (w0/120*E*I*L) instead of w/(120*E*I*L)

Yes, for the delflection of the beams, EI should be on the bottom of the fraction
